Nathalie-

One of the most anticipated releases this year (by me) Anne Fontaine's new film NATHALIE starring the beautiful Emmanuelle Beart (including Fanny Ardant and Gerard Depardieu) has gotten a release "date"- September (RAMA)


Specific date and disc specs however are not revealed at this point by the French distribs- StudioCanal. (According to LocaFilm the disc will offer English subs)

Nathalie was shown earlier this year in NY as part of the Rendez-Vous film series (an R1 distrib is also secured so it seems that some time in the future a North American release will be available).

So, Pro-B (& indeed anyone else), what did you make of the actual film?
I missed it at cinemas here, and heard almost nothing but negative things about it; however, I really liked it. I admit (and as others have pointed out) it doesn't take long for you to realise where it's heading, but getting there makes for an interesting journey. The three main cast are (unsurprisingly) all very good, but I feel that Ardant really walks away with the film.
Echoing Pro-B's earlier post, I too think the actual disc is excellent. It cost me about €22 in-store (which is about what I'd expect), but really is worth every cent. It's not loaded with extras, but the 1/2 hr "making of..." and interesting-sounding commentary from Ardant/Fontaine (I've only listened to a couple of minutes of it) are good enough for me.
